Why are Warzone lobbies so hard?

Warzone lobbies feel hard due to Activision's opaque Skill-Based Matchmaking (SBMM) that pushes you into tougher games after good performances, a large pool of dedicated, high-skill players (especially with crossplay), the fast Time-To-Kill (TTK) requiring quick reactions, and evolving game mechanics that reward aggressive, tactical play, making even "average" games feel "sweaty".

Are Warzone lobbies skill-based?

In addition to skill, Call of Duty's matchmaking algorithm considers several other factors: Connection (Ping): This remains the top priority in matchmaking, as a strong connection is crucial for a smooth gaming experience. Time to Match: Ensuring players spend more time playing rather than waiting for a match.

Why are Warzone lobbies not filling?

Generally speaking, there are three possible methods to fix lobbies not filling up in Warzone 2: 1. Enable Crossplay in the Account and Network settings menu 2. Restart Warzone 2 entirely by closing it manually and then reopening it 3. Choose a different game mode.

Is CoD getting rid of skill-based matchmaking?

Yes, Call of Duty (specifically Black Ops 7) has introduced "Open Matchmaking" in some playlists, like the "Open Mosh Pit," where Skill-Based Matchmaking (SBMM) is "minimally considered," offering a less sweaty, classic feel with faster matches and persistent lobbies, though some players still find skill levels mixed in, leading to debate about how much SBMM is truly gone in those modes versus standard SBMM playlists.

Does Warzone use bots?

Yes, Warzone does have bots, primarily in specific modes like the "Casual" Battle Royale (often with a mix of bots and players) and the dedicated "Bootcamp" training mode, but they also get injected into standard modes to fill lobbies, especially for lower-skilled or returning players, though they are programmed to behave like real players and can be hard to distinguish sometimes. You'll find them in lower-tier matches or isolated spots, often with generic names and predictable patterns, but their presence helps new players learn without getting immediately overwhelmed by veterans.

How do I aim better in Warzone?

To get better aim in Warzone, master centering (keeping your crosshair at chest level where enemies might appear), practice recoil control by pulling the stick opposite the gun's pattern, optimize your controller/mouse settings (lower sens initially, turn off vibration/motion blur, use "Affected" ADS FOV), and always use left stick movement (strafe) to activate rotational aim assist during fights, say experts on 3D Aim Trainer, Reddit users, and YouTube creators. Consistent practice in the firing range and private matches is key to building muscle memory.

Can you get banned for using bot lobbies?

Yes, you absolutely can get banned for using or facilitating bot lobbies, as it violates most games' Terms of Service (ToS) by manipulating matchmaking and boosting stats, leading to penalties like temporary suspensions, permanent bans, or stat resets, especially in competitive modes. While some minor VPN use for easier lobbies might be tolerated if it's just server latency, actively buying or selling access to boosted/bot lobbies is strictly against rules and risks severe account action.

Is COD Warzone skill-based?

Yes, Call of Duty: Warzone uses Skill-Based Matchmaking (SBMM) to group players of similar performance, meaning better players face tougher lobbies, though it's a debated topic with some players feeling it's inconsistent or that "skill-based damage" might exist for bots, making matches feel rigged. The system adjusts dynamically based on K/D, wins, and other metrics, aiming for balanced matches, but many players still encounter highly skilled opponents regularly, especially in core BR modes.
